Flat roof sealing services involve applying specialized coatings or sealants to the surface of flat roofs to create a protective barrier. This process helps prevent water from seeping through the roofing material, which is especially important for flat roofs that are more prone to pooling water and leaks. The application of sealant can be done on existing roofs to reinforce their waterproofing capabilities or as part of a maintenance routine to extend the lifespan of the roof. Skilled service providers use proven materials and techniques to ensure the sealant adheres properly, providing a durable and weather-resistant layer.
One of the primary problems that flat roof sealing addresses is water infiltration. Over time, exposure to rain, snow, and temperature fluctuations can cause cracks, blisters, or deterioration in the roofing material. These issues allow moisture to penetrate the roof structure, potentially leading to leaks, mold growth, and structural damage. Sealing the roof helps to fill small cracks and prevent water from entering, reducing the risk of costly repairs and interior water damage. It also helps protect against the effects of UV rays and temperature changes that can accelerate wear and tear.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or flat roof sealing projects in Scranton range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and complexity of the area being sealed.
Medium-Sized Projects - Sealing larger sections or multiple areas usually costs between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homes with extensive flat roofing that require more extensive work.
Full Roof Sealing - Complete sealing of an entire flat roof can range from $1,500 to $3,500, with many local contractors handling projects in this range. Larger or more complex roofs may push costs higher but are less frequent.
Full Replacement or Major Repairs - For extensive damage or complete roof replacement, costs can reach $5,000 or more. Such projects are less common and typically involve significant structural work beyond sealing alone.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is flat roof sealing? Flat roof sealing involves applying a protective coating to prevent water leaks and improve the roof's durability.
Why should I consider sealing my flat roof? Sealing can help extend the lifespan of a flat roof by preventing water infiltration and reducing damage caused by weather elements.
What types of materials are used for flat roof sealing? Common sealing materials include liquid membranes, asphalt-based coatings, and rubberized sealants suitable for flat roofs.
How do local contractors prepare a flat roof for sealing? They typically inspect the roof for damage, clean the surface thoroughly, and repair any existing issues before applying the sealant.
Can flat roof sealing be done on any type of flat roof? Most flat roofs can be sealed, but the suitability depends on the roof's material and condition; a local service provider can assess this.
